Overview

Location: Primarily Remote; One day per week onsite in Canonsburg, PA

Job Type: Full time

Work Authorization: U.S. Citizen or Green Card

 

The A.C. Coy Company has an immediate need for an HR Operations Specialist. This individual will play a key role in supporting day-to-day HR operations across benefits, leave administration, onboarding/offboarding, and employee data management, while leveraging technology to streamline processes and improve reporting accuracy.

 

Our ideal candidate will have 3+ years of experience in a corporate Human Resources role, strong HRIS and Excel skills, and a good working knowledge of employee relations, benefits administration, leave administration, on/offboarding, and HR reporting.

 

The company offers a strong salary and benefits package, including medical, dental, and vision coverage, 401K with match, and unlimited PTO.

Responsibilities

HR Operations & Employee Support 

  • Provide routine employee support by responding to HR-related questions and requests 
  • Escalate complex employee relations, benefit, or leave issues as appropriate 
  • Maintain employee documentation and provide general administrative HR support 
  • Support and track key HR processes to ensure timely and accurate completion 
  • Coordinate and manage HR process workflows, ensuring consistency and efficiency 

Onboarding & Offboarding 

  • Coordinate onboarding and offboarding processes end-to-end 
  • Send welcome communications and new hire materials 
  • Initiate and monitor background checks 
  • Enter employee data into ADP and other systems 
  • Partner with IT to generate and track onboarding/offboarding tickets 

Benefits Administration 

  • Support administration of benefits programs including enrollments, terminations, and life events 
  • Respond to general employee benefit inquiries and escalate complex issues as needed 
  • Assist with invoice reconciliation and vendor coordination 
  • Support open enrollment planning, coordination, and communications 

Leave Administration 

  • Support leave of absence processes including tracking, documentation, and communication 
  • Coordinate STD/LTD paperwork and ensure timely submission 
  • Ensure a smooth and organized leave process for employees and managers 

HR Systems, Data & Reporting 

  • Maintain employee data within HR systems ensuring accuracy and integrity 
  • Run and distribute routine and ad hoc reports 

Qualifications

Required:

 

  • 3+ years of experience in an HR Operations role
  • Exposure to benefits and leave administration (including FMLA, STD/LTD) 
  • Experience supporting benefits, onboarding/offboarding, and HR operations processes
  • Proficiency with an HRIS; Experience with HR reporting tools or dashboards 
  • Strong Excel skills (data organization, formulas, pivot tables) 
  • Working knowledge of MS SharePoint 

Preferred:

 

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
  • Proficiency with ADP Workforce Now
  • Experience supporting multi-state and/or Canadian workforce 
  • Familiarity and experience building custom reports
